Deputy Finance Director - San Joaquin General
TYPICAL DUTIES
* Plans, supervises and participates in the preparation and monitoring comprehensive annual budgets in compliance with County, State and Federal regulations.
* Directs complex cost accounting systems which reflect a variety of funding sources; assures that costs are properly allocated; monitors revenues and expenditures to assure compliance with budget assures that necessary adjustments are made.
* Prepares annual cost reports; submits to various State and Federal agencies for review, justification of expenditures, and reimbursement; coordinates audit activities performed by County, State, and Federal agencies; analyzes results of audits and prepares appeals of audit exceptions.
* Manages department insurance billing, credit, and collection functions through subordinate staff.
* Directs the maintenance of general ledger systems; analyzes general ledger reports; develops special reports as required.
* Supervises and participates in the preparation, maintenance and monitoring of contracts, leases, inter-agency agreements, and rental agreements between the department and outside agencies.
* Maintains liaison with Departmental Systems Coordinator to assure appropriateness of data processing programs related to fiscally oriented management information systems.
* Advises the Public Conservator/Guardian and other County officials regarding conservatorship client investments.
* Selects, assigns, trains, supervise and evaluates professional and clerical staff.
* May act for the Finance Director in his absence; acts as liaison with State and Federal agencies, the County-Auditor-Controller, County departments, and other agencies as required.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Education:
Graduation from an accredited four year college or university with a major in Business Administration, Accounting, Economics, or closely related field, including at least twelve semester units in accounting.
Experience:
Four years professional accounting or auditing experience including one year supervising the preparation and analysis of complex cost reports and/or budgets.
Substitution:
Additional experience may be substituted for the required education on a year-for-year basis to a maximum of two years.
KNOWLEDGE
Principles, practices, methods and techniques of accounting, financial management, public administration and management analysis; electronic data processing as applied to a computerized general ledger system; financial forecasting; preparation financial statements; public agency operating budgets; regulatory practices in county, state, and federal jurisdictions and their impact on public agency accounting; principles of office management.
ABILITY
Plan, organize, direct and control the financial activities of a complex organization; develop sound financial strategy; develop and implement complex accounting systems and fiscal controls; train and supervise professional and non-professional staff; gather and analyze data; prepare complex financial and statistical reports; interpret and apply complex rules and regulations; prepare contracts, leases and other agreements; establish and maintain effective working relationships with others.
